Low temperatures considerably have an effect on the operation of diesel engines. The viscosity of diesel gas will increase in chilly situations, which may hinder correct gas circulate and atomization. This could result in beginning difficulties, tough working, and lowered energy output. For instance, gas thickening can stop it from flowing freely by means of gas traces and filters, ravenous the engine of gas.
